diff options
Diffstat (limited to 'build/libs/asura-lib-utils/x64/Debug/thread_impl_win32.nativecodeanalysis.xml')
-rw-r--r-- | build/libs/asura-lib-utils/x64/Debug/thread_impl_win32.nativecodeanalysis.xml | 73 |
1 files changed, 73 insertions, 0 deletions
diff --git a/build/libs/asura-lib-utils/x64/Debug/thread_impl_win32.nativecodeanalysis.xml b/build/libs/asura-lib-utils/x64/Debug/thread_impl_win32.nativecodeanalysis.xml new file mode 100644 index 0000000..e0b1c6b --- /dev/null +++ b/build/libs/asura-lib-utils/x64/Debug/thread_impl_win32.nativecodeanalysis.xml @@ -0,0 +1,73 @@ +<?xml version="1.0" encoding="UTF-8"?> +<DEFECTS> + <DEFECT> + <SFA> + <FILEPATH>d:\asura\source\libs\asura-lib-utils\threading\</FILEPATH> + <FILENAME>mutex.h</FILENAME> + <LINE>39</LINE> + <COLUMN>3</COLUMN> + </SFA> + <DEFECTCODE>26439</DEFECTCODE> + <DESCRIPTION>This kind of function may not throw. Declare it 'noexcept' (f.6).</DESCRIPTION> + <FUNCTION>AsuraEngine::Threading::MutexImpl::{ctor}</FUNCTION> + <DECORATED>??0MutexImpl@Threading@AsuraEngine@@QEAA@XZ</DECORATED> + <FUNCLINE>39</FUNCLINE> + <PATH></PATH> + </DEFECT> + <DEFECT> + <SFA> + <FILEPATH>d:\asura\source\libs\asura-lib-utils\threading\</FILEPATH> + <FILENAME>thread.h</FILENAME> + <LINE>90</LINE> + <COLUMN>3</COLUMN> + </SFA> + <DEFECTCODE>26439</DEFECTCODE> + <DESCRIPTION>This kind of function may not throw. Declare it 'noexcept' (f.6).</DESCRIPTION> + <FUNCTION>AsuraEngine::Threading::ThreadImpl::{ctor}</FUNCTION> + <DECORATED>??0ThreadImpl@Threading@AsuraEngine@@QEAA@XZ</DECORATED> + <FUNCLINE>90</FUNCLINE> + <PATH></PATH> + </DEFECT> + <DEFECT> + <SFA> + <FILEPATH>d:\asura\source\libs\asura-lib-utils\threading\</FILEPATH> + <FILENAME>thread_impl_win32.cpp</FILENAME> + <LINE>16</LINE> + <COLUMN>19</COLUMN> + </SFA> + <DEFECTCODE>26495</DEFECTCODE> + <DESCRIPTION>Variable 'AsuraEngine::Threading::ThreadImplWin32::mHandle' is uninitialized. Always initialize a member variable (type.6).</DESCRIPTION> + <FUNCTION>AsuraEngine::Threading::ThreadImplWin32::{ctor}</FUNCTION> + <DECORATED>??0ThreadImplWin32@Threading@AsuraEngine@@QEAA@XZ</DECORATED> + <FUNCLINE>16</FUNCLINE> + <PATH></PATH> + </DEFECT> + <DEFECT> + <SFA> + <FILEPATH>d:\asura\source\libs\asura-lib-utils\threading\</FILEPATH> + <FILENAME>thread_impl_win32.cpp</FILENAME> + <LINE>16</LINE> + <COLUMN>19</COLUMN> + </SFA> + <DEFECTCODE>26439</DEFECTCODE> + <DESCRIPTION>This kind of function may not throw. Declare it 'noexcept' (f.6).</DESCRIPTION> + <FUNCTION>AsuraEngine::Threading::ThreadImplWin32::{ctor}</FUNCTION> + <DECORATED>??0ThreadImplWin32@Threading@AsuraEngine@@QEAA@XZ</DECORATED> + <FUNCLINE>16</FUNCLINE> + <PATH></PATH> + </DEFECT> + <DEFECT> + <SFA> + <FILEPATH>d:\asura\source\libs\asura-lib-utils\threading\</FILEPATH> + <FILENAME>thread_impl_win32.cpp</FILENAME> + <LINE>49</LINE> + <COLUMN>20</COLUMN> + </SFA> + <DEFECTCODE>6258</DEFECTCODE> + <DESCRIPTION>使用 TerminateThread 将不允许进行适当的线程清理。</DESCRIPTION> + <FUNCTION>AsuraEngine::Threading::ThreadImplWin32::Kill</FUNCTION> + <DECORATED>?Kill@ThreadImplWin32@Threading@AsuraEngine@@UEAAXXZ</DECORATED> + <FUNCLINE>47</FUNCLINE> + <PATH></PATH> + </DEFECT> +</DEFECTS>
\ No newline at end of file |